Radio silence

By Kenneth Rainey. Filed under: News, TweedBlog.

Many internet radio stations are going offline today to protest the recent royalty rate hike that may put them out of business. Wired has more information on the day of silence. Many web radio stations will go off the air permanently on July 15th if Congress does not intervene. To find out what you can do to help prevent this, visit SaveNetRadio.org.
